Bahadurgarh

Bahadurgarh is a Town and Tehsil in Jhajjar District of Haryana. In India, a tehsil is a sub-division of a district that is responsible for the administration and revenue collection of a particular area within the district. It is an important part of the local governance structure, and plays a crucial role in the development and administration of its local community.

According to Census 2011, the sub-district code of Bahadurgarh Block (CD) is 00408. The total area of Bahadurgarh Tehsil is 517 km², which includes 478.67 km² of rural area and 38.23 km² of urban area. Bahadurgarh has a sex ratio of approximately 848 females per 1,000 males.

Population of Bahadurgarh Tehsil

The population profile of Bahadurgarh Tehsil offers a deeper understanding of how people are settled across its rural and urban parts. The following sections provide key insights into total population, household distribution, literacy, and age demographics — data that plays a vital role in planning development work and allocating public resources effectively.

Basic Population Details

This section offers a snapshot of Bahadurgarh Tehsil's population composition, including male-female ratio, child population, and how literacy levels vary between villages and towns.

Particulars Total Rural Urban
Total Population 4,03,746 2,26,074 1,77,672
Male Population 2,18,433 1,22,895 95,538
Female Population 1,85,313 1,03,179 82,134
Child Population (Age 0–6) 50,446 27,926 22,520
Male Child Population (Age 0–6) 28,439 15,906 12,533
Female Child Population (Age 0–6) 22,007 12,020 9,987
Literate Population 2,92,686 1,61,310 1,31,376
Literate Male Population 1,71,129 96,118 75,011
Literate Female Population 1,21,557 65,192 56,365
Illiterate Population 1,11,060 64,764 46,296
Illiterate Male Population 47,304 26,777 20,527
Illiterate Female Population 63,756 37,987 25,769
Total Households 79,101 42,756 36,345

Here’s a simplified summary based on Census 2011 stats:

  • Total population of Bahadurgarh Tehsil is around 4,03,746 people. This includes 2,18,433 males and 1,85,313 females. Rural population is about 2,26,074 (1,22,895 males and 1,03,179 females), while urban population is nearly 1,77,672 (95,538 males and 82,134 females).
  • Children aged 0–6 years make up about 50,446 of the population, with 28,439 boys and 22,007 girls. Rural areas have 27,926 children, and urban areas have about 22,520 children in this age group.
  • There are approximately 2,92,686 literate people in Bahadurgarh Tehsil, including 1,71,129 literate males and 1,21,557 literate females. Literacy in rural areas includes 1,61,310 individuals and urban literacy covers around 1,31,376 people.
  • About 1,11,060 people in Bahadurgarh Tehsil are not literate, including 47,304 males and 63,756 females. Rural areas include 64,764 non-literate people, while urban areas have nearly 46,296 individuals.
  • The tehsil has around 79,101 households, with 42,756 in villages and 36,345 in towns.

Social Structure and Density

This section offers a snapshot of social structure in Bahadurgarh Tehsil, highlighting the SC and ST population across rural and urban areas, as well as how densely people live in different parts of the region.

Particulars Total Rural Urban
Total SC Population 65,835 36,704 29,131
SC Male Population 35,279 19,775 15,504
SC Female Population 30,556 16,929 13,627
Total ST Population N/A N/A N/A
ST Male Population N/A N/A N/A
ST Female Population N/A N/A N/A
Population Density 781 / km² 472 / km² 4,647 / km²

Here’s a simplified summary based on Census 2011 stats:

  • Scheduled Caste (SC) population in Bahadurgarh Tehsil is approximately 65,835 people, including 35,279 males and 30,556 females. Around 36,704 people live in rural parts. Nearly 29,131 people reside in urban areas.
  • In terms of density, overall population density is around 781 people per square kilometre, rural areas have about 472 people per sq. km, urban areas record nearly 4,647 people per sq. km.
